The Sheffield neighborhood is located in a pocket of the larger Lincoln Park Chicago community on the north side of the city. Much of Sheffield is designated with historical status owing to its McCormick row houses and period architecture. As a vibrant Chicago neighborhood, Sheffield features a mix of residential and commercial properties. Location

Part of the greater Lincoln Park Chicago area, Sheffield is located within easy distance of the Chicago Loop and the popular Lakeview Chicago neighborhood, home of the Chicago Cubs at Wrigley Field. Fullerton Avenue, Halstead Street, Armitage Avenue, and the Chicago River make up its boundaries. Nearby neighborhoods include Park West, Old Town Triangle, and Lincoln Central.

Sheffield Chicago Neighborhood Amenities

The Sheffield neighborhood is slightly more than five miles from the Loop, which makes it an extremely popular place to live, especially if you work or enjoy spending time downtown. Public transportation in Sheffield is extremely reliable. The CTA red, purple, and brown lines operate in the area. Residents also have access to major thruways like Lakeshore Drive and the Kennedy Expressway.

Sheffield residents are served by the Chicago Public School District along with charter, private, and parochial schools. DePaul University makes its home in the area as well. With area attractions like the Alfred Caldwell Lily Pool, Apollo Theatre, Lincoln Park Zoo, and the DePaul Art Center, it's tough to be bored in this part of the city!

The Sheffield Chicago neighborhood area features a diverse range of restaurants that include La Roccia, Sapori Trattoria, 7 Plates Café, Range, Café Ba-Ba-Reeba, Blue Door Farm Stand, Toast, Boka, Café Vienna, and Pequod's Pizzeria—to name a mere few! Residents of Sheffield also love nearby entertainment and club venues like Sheffield's Beer & Wine Garden, Derby, and Kincade's. Sheffield Real Estate

Chicago real estate in the Sheffield and Lincoln Park areas does not come too cheap, but there are affordable properties and your Chicago real estate agent can help you work with your budget to find a great space in this part of the city. As mentioned, much of Sheffield is regarded as an historic district. Brick row houses, brown and gray-stone walk-ups make up the fabric of the neighborhood. Many of the buildings boast historic architectural details that enhance the vintage feel of this part of the city. The median home price in the area is about $580,000. That price climbs even higher in other areas of Lincoln Park.
